A scope that will not hold zero is blamed on the scope, the ammunition, or the rifle far more often than it is traced back to the rings, and the rings are usually where the problem actually starts. A tube forced into rings that do not point at the same place is bent slightly out of true before a single shot is fired, and that preload shows up later as a scope that tracks differently dialing up than it does dialing down.

A mounting kit exists to catch this before the scope goes in permanently. Alignment bars show whether the two rings are pointed at the same place with no scope involved at all, using a straight bar that either passes through both rings cleanly or reveals exactly where they are off. Lapping then removes the high spots inside the rings so the tube is gripped evenly across its full contact surface rather than pinched at four points where the ring halves happen to meet.

What alignment bars actually check

An alignment bar is a straight rod, slightly under the tube's own diameter, that sits in the bottom halves of both rings before the scope ever goes near them. If the rings are pointed at exactly the same place, the bar passes through both cleanly with even clearance on every side. If the rings are off, even slightly, the bar binds or shows daylight unevenly on one side, and that gap is a direct picture of how far out of alignment the rings are before the scope's own tube has to absorb the difference.

This test costs nothing but time and happens before the scope is anywhere near the rifle, which is exactly the point. Once a real scope tube goes into misaligned rings, the tube itself flexes slightly to take up the gap, and that flex does not go away when the rings are tightened. It becomes a permanent, invisible preload on the erector system inside the scope.

Why lapping matters even when the rings look fine

A ring that grips a tube unevenly is doing the same thing to the scope's erector system that misaligned rings do, just through a different mechanism. Instead of a straight-line bend from one ring to the other, an unlapped ring pinches the tube at a small number of contact points, which can distort the tube by a barely measurable amount right where the erector assembly needs it to be perfectly round to track true.

This is the direct, physical explanation behind the symptom shooters describe as a scope that will not return to zero: dial ten clicks up, come back down ten clicks, and the point of impact has shifted slightly rather than returning exactly to where it started. The erector is binding against a subtly deformed tube wall rather than moving freely, and no amount of re-torquing rings that are already lapped correctly will fix a problem that was never in the torque to begin with.

The problem lapping solves

A ring bore that is not perfectly round grips a tube at a small number of high points rather than across its full contact surface. Lapping compound and an abrasive-coated bar wear those high points down until the ring contacts the tube evenly all the way around.

A ring can pass a visual and even a bar-fit check and still have this problem, because the high spots involved are often only a few thousandths of an inch, invisible to the eye and barely felt by hand.

How to lap a set of scope rings

  1. Confirm the rifle is unloaded. Open the action, check the chamber, and leave the action open for the entire process. Nothing about mounting a scope is worth doing on a loaded rifle.
  2. Mount the bases and rings loosely. Install the bases and ring bottoms, torqued only enough to hold position, not to final specification. Lapping needs the rings able to shift slightly.
  3. Check alignment with the bars first. Run the alignment bar through both ring bottoms before adding any lapping compound. If the bar reveals a gap on one side, correct the base or ring position before proceeding, since lapping cannot fix a straight-line misalignment.
  4. Apply the compound and work the bar. Coat the lapping bar with the supplied compound, lay it in the ring bottoms, and set the top halves in place without full torque. Rotate and slide the bar back and forth through both rings for even, moderate contact.
  5. Clean thoroughly and inspect. Remove every trace of compound from the rings before the scope goes anywhere near them, since any remaining grit will scratch the tube's finish. Look for a consistent, even contact band around the full bore of each ring.
  6. Install the scope and torque to specification. Set the scope in the lapped rings, level it, and torque the ring screws in a criss-cross pattern to the scope manufacturer's specification with a proper torque wrench, never by feel.

Frequently asked questions

What do scope ring alignment bars actually check?

Whether the two rings point at exactly the same place before the scope tube ever gets involved. A straight bar sits in both ring bottoms at once, and any binding or uneven gap shows precisely how far out of alignment the rings are, which is the straight-line problem lapping cannot fix on its own.

Why lap scope rings if they already look aligned?

Alignment and lapping fix two different problems. Alignment checks whether the rings point the same direction. Lapping removes the microscopic high spots inside each ring so the tube is gripped evenly across its full contact surface rather than pinched at a few points, which can distort the tube enough to affect tracking even in perfectly aligned rings.

What happens if I skip lapping?

Rings that grip a tube unevenly can preload the scope's erector system, producing a scope that shifts point of impact slightly when dialed up and back down rather than returning exactly to zero. This is one of the more common causes behind that specific symptom, and it is invisible from the outside once the scope is mounted.

Can lapping compound damage the scope tube?

Lapping compound is applied to the rings, not the scope, and the scope tube should never be present during the lapping step itself. The risk is leftover compound not fully cleaned from the rings before the real scope goes in, which can scratch the tube's finish. Clean thoroughly and inspect before mounting the actual scope.

Do I need different lapping bars for 30mm and 34mm tubes?

Yes. A lapping bar has to match the ring's bore diameter closely enough to make even contact, so a 30mm kit and a 34mm kit are different, non-interchangeable tools. Check the tube diameter of the scope you are mounting before buying a standalone lapping kit rather than assuming one size fits both.

Is a mounting kit worth it over just mounting a scope by eye?

For a one-time mount on a budget rifle, a careful eye and a level can produce an acceptable result. For any scope you expect to hold zero reliably over years of use and recoil, alignment bars and lapping catch problems that are invisible by eye and only show up later as unpredictable tracking, which is a far more expensive problem to diagnose after the fact.
